Pumpkin Sambar
#SM
This pumpkin is from my garden; Beautiful yellow color, rich healthy nutrients. All parts of the pumpkin can be eaten. Seeds, skin and even leaves. Spicy, aromatic, tasty and flavorful sambar

- 3
Cook the lentils, toor and moong in a bowl with 3c water in a pressure cooker
When The lentils are cooking in the cooker, attend to the rest of the chores.
To make the paste:
Fry the paste : fry paste ingredients ingredients in 1 tbsp hot oil in a frying pan over medium heat. Fry the dhals, and coriander seeds first. the dhals will turn golden. Add the chilies Turn off the stove when aromatic. soak the fried ingredients in water., 15 minutes, blend in a mixie to make a smooth paste - 4
In a heavy kadai over medium heat add the oil, 1 tbsp ghee. Add the mustard seeds, let it splutter, stir in Fennel, hing, methi and red chilies. Sauté Onions, garlic, green chilies, and curry leaves. Add turmeric When onion turns slightly brown add the tomatoes, stir; cook for 3-4 mins. Let the tomatoes get soft. Add 3 cups water, bring it to boil.
- 5
Then add pumpkin slices; Reduce heat slightly after boiling. Add the cooked lentils and stir well. Add 3 cups water and sambar masala powder and stir. Dilute tamarind paste in 1 cup water, add to the rest, stir and bring to a boil. Stir in the coconut paste. After a couple of minutes turn off the stove.
- 6
Add salt, remaining ghee and garnish with chopped coriander leaves
Delicious nutritious fragrant spicy sambar is ready to taste.
Taste. You may serve the sambar with Rice, chapati, parantha, adai. Idli, or Dosa
